TTI Leonettibus

About
TTI Leonettibus is an Italian bus company established in 1999, specializing in long-distance bus lines and GT (Gran Turismo) coach tourism. They operate a fleet of modern buses, including Gran Turismo coaches and minibuses, with a focus on comfort, safety, and punctuality. TTI Leonettibus offers routes connecting various Italian cities, including direct services to Rome (Tiburtina and Fiumicino Airport) from locations like Fisciano, Salerno, Cava de' Tirreni, Nocera Inferiore, and Angri. They also have a ministerial line from Fisciano to Milan, with stops in Rome, Florence, Modena, and Bologna, and seasonal summer routes to destinations like Gallipoli. The company is also involved in organizing transfers for cruise ship tourists and school groups.

Luggage included
One suitcase and one shoulder bag are included in the ticket price.
Additional luggage
Additional luggage is allowed, subject to space availability and may require an extra ticket.
Luggage storage
Luggage is stored in the bus's luggage compartment, which is unguarded.
Unaccompagned minor
Minors under 14 years old are not allowed to travel unaccompanied; those aged 14 to 18 require written authorization from a parent or guardian.
Amenities on board the bus
Seat reservation
Seat reservations are mandatory and nominative; the return trip must also be reserved.
Bikes
Foldable bicycles are allowed for free if in a bag measuring 80x100x40 cm; non-foldable bicycles are allowed for €2.00 in the luggage compartment; electric bicycles are prohibited.
Pets
Small pets are allowed if kept in a carrier measuring up to 70x30x50 cm; larger animals are not permitted.

Euro (€)

Moderate for Italy. Hotels and dining are usually cheaper than major tourist cities, while local trains and buses keep transport costs reasonable.

Average meal costs

Budget
€8-12 for pizza, panini, or fast food.
Mid-range
€18-30 per person for a restaurant meal.
Fine dining
€50+ per person for upscale dining.
Coffee
€1.20-2.50 for espresso or cappuccino.

Tipping culture

Service is often included or minimal. Round up at cafes and taxis, and leave €1-2 or about 5-10% at restaurants for good service.
